Reasons why the screw pump does not deliver flow

2010-03-11View Original

Thread Content

As the title suggests, 1. The inlet filter was not clogged after being removed, but the filter screen was damaged. 2. The inlet pressure of the pump is 2 kilograms (normal), while the outlet pressure is 4.2 kilograms; it should be 8 kilograms under normal conditions. 3. Is it a problem with the pump’s relief valve? What other reasons could cause the screw pump not to deliver fluid? Please help analyze what might be the cause. Thank you.

The main reason why the screw pump fails to deliver fluid is the presence of particulate impurities in the material being transported; these impurities increase the gap between the screw of the pump and its casing, resulting in a decrease in outlet pressure and reduced flow rate. The main reason is that the imported filter screen was damaged, allowing impurities to enter the pump.

1. The motor wires are connected in reverse, resulting in incorrect direction of rotation and no production; 2. Screw wear and excessive clearance: During maintenance, components such as the screws are cleaned, which causes changes in their clearance ; 3. Pump body safety valve failure: The spring fails, causing it to activate at a pressure lower than the normal level (4.2 kilograms) ; 4. Changes in medium-related properties?
